ArvutidProgrammeerimine

Objektorienteeritud programmeerimine

Objektorienteeritud programmeerimine - meetod võimalikult lähedal meie käitumist. See toimib loomulik jätk varem uuendusi arendamisega seotud programmeerimiskeeli. Kui me räägime struktureeritud programmeerimise, siis selles suunas on palju struktureeritud kui varasem versioon, lisaks on veel abstraktne, moodulitena. Oleme juba katsed vabastada ja liiguta programmeerimine elemente nn sisemise tasandil.

Objekt-orienteeritud programmeerimine on kasutada arendamiseks spetsialiseeritud keeled. Nad on tavaliselt iseloomustab kolm peamist tunnusjoont:

- kapseldus, st kombinatsioon kirjed funktsioone ja protseduure, samuti manipuleerides kirjeid andmeväljad, mis moodustavad täiesti uut tüüpi andmebaasi, mida nimetatakse objekti;

- pärandi objekti määratlus tähendab hilisema kasutamise ehitada objektide hierarhia loodud võime genereerida uus objekt on seotud hierarhia, samuti tähendab juurdepääsu koodi ja tekitada teavet kõigi objektide;

- polümorfismi, mis tähendab, võime määrata meetmete sama nime, mis siis jagatakse üles ja alla objekti hierarhia ja hierarhia iga objekti meetme rakendamiseks sel viisil on vastutus, mis on tema jaoks õige.

Objektorienteeritud programmeerimine Delphi pakub komplekt tööriistu programmeerimine, mille hulgas on: suurem moodulitest ja struktureeritud abstraktne, sisseehitatud võime uuesti kasutada. Kõik need omadused võib seostada kood, mis on rohkem struktureeritud, rohkem lihtne teenuste osas ja palju paindlikum. Väga sageli on objektorienteeritud programmeerimise teeb meist jätta kõrvale konkreetsed otsused programmeerimise aastaid pidada standard. Samas, kui see on tehtud, protsessi arengut ei tundu nii keeruline ja tundub selge ja suurepärane vahend erinevaid ülesandeid, pakkudes suurt vaeva triviaalne tarkvara.

Kui olete teinud meie ülesanne, näiteks uurida objektorienteeritud programmeerimine PHP, on vaja ära visata ja unustada, mida sa tead seda enne ja tuli oma uuringus puhtalt lehelt. Ainult nii on võimalik näha kõiki üksikasju selle lähenemise hindamiseks oma kasutatavus ja funktsioonid. Objektorienteeritud programmeerimine ei ole ainus viis, see on rohkem nagu katkematu ideid keskendunud koostamisel puhta koodi. Koostaja töötab mitu erinevat põhimõtteid, kui me võrdleme seda tõlk, samas kui tema kiirus on palju suurem. Koostajad on suunatud arendada mis tahes valmis tarkvara tooteid, mitte piiratud hulga ülesannetega.

klasside

Enne seda oli loodud objektorienteeritud programmeerimiskeeli palju sündmusi käärinud vajadust laiendatud andmetüüpe kui reaalne ja täisarve, teksti muutujate ja Boole'i muutujad. See muutub raske töötada täisarv andmeid massiivid. Seda kasutatakse klasside OOP mõisted. Sellise struktuuride sai palju lihtsam töötada, sest nüüd sama objekti ei pea registreerima palju ridu koodi saada midagi, mis saab luua automaatselt. Madala taseme programmeerimiskeeli selline meetod tundub olevat väga raske, kuid uus arenguetapp seda kasutada üsna mugavalt.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 et.unansea.com. Theme powered by WordPress.